Remembrance of The Return of the King to The Hague, from the flooded places, February 9, 1861 (title on object), King Willem III returns to The Hague after a visit to the areas affected by the flood, February 9, 1861. carriage with the king, Crown Prince Willem and Prince Hendrik drives to Noordeinde Palace to loud cheers from the public. On the left the equestrian statue of William of Orange., print, print maker: Gerardus Johannes Bos, (mentioned on object), after drawing by: Elchanon Verveer, (mentioned on object), printer: Samuel Lankhout, (mentioned on object), print maker: Netherlands, after drawing by: Netherlands, printer: The Hague, publisher: The Hague, 1861, paper, height, 450 mm × width, 573 mm
